Bulb onions, like red, white, sweet, and yellow onions are similar, but with subtle differences. • Red onions have greater astringency and bring tears to eyes prompting people to soak them in water for some time to make them milder. Caramelized onions are usually cross-cut on the onion to release its moisture, and then cooked over very low heat in a crowded pan, stirring infrequently, so that they gradually release their sugars and liquid and it turns to caramel.
